Homemade Ombre Nail Manicure by Lindsay Myers

I never go really big or bold with my manicures. However, now in confinement, I have the time to figure out how to do it myself, after all, I don’t have the choice!
Supplies:
Any sponge (you just need a little bit, cut off a section from a larger sponge)
Plastic wrap
toothpick
Directions: Paint your nails with the lightest colour. Let it dry. On the plastic pour our a little of each colour right beside each other so they touch. Take the toothpick and swirl/blend just in the area where the two colours meet. Next, take your sponge and dab it directly over this mixture and then dab the sponge directly on your nail. Keep going on all the nails. If you want to go back over the nails to make the colour stronger just make sure the first coat is dry first. Finish with a clear topcoat.
